In what way, is the electronic configuration of transition elements different from that of non- transition elements ? |
|
Answer» SOLUTION :The transition ELEMENTS INVOLVE the filled d- orbitals whereas the representative elements involve the filling of s or p-orbitals. General electronic configuration of transition element :`(n-1) d^(1) - 10 s^(1 - 2)` General electronic configuration of representative elements : `ns^(1 - 2)` or `ns^(2)NP^(1-6)`. On comparison of the above electronic configurations, we FIND that in the representative elements, only the last shell is incomplete whereas in transition elements the last but one shell is also incomplete. |
